(14.9% alcohol; 44% To Kalon): Very dark color. Highly aromatic nose combines black cherry, anise, menthol, dried herbs and bay laurel, plus a whiff of dark chocolate. Then almost surprisingly plush and ripe in the mouth, with a slightly porty dried-berry quality nicely leavened by brisk notes of pepper and spices. Finishes with a firm tannic spine but no dryness.
A dense ruby/purple color is followed by a wine exhibiting notes of creme de cassis, subtle and unobtrusive oak, medium to full body, impeccable balance and everything synchronized into a lush, opulent wine that finished with 14.5% alcohol. It is not the most complex Mondavi Reserve, but it is a very satisfying, highbrow wine that offers plenty of pleasure both hedonistically and intellectually. It should drink well for another 15 years, and it may surprise me with more nuances and subtleties than it now suggests.
Anticipated maturity: 2013-2028
